Leonardo Hotel Groningen is a 4-star hotel in Groningen, Netherlands. Located about 1.4mi from the city center, the property sits at Laan Van De Vrijheid 91. Prices start from $97.
Key amenities include a Restaurant, free Wifi, Bar, Room service, 24-hour front desk, air conditioning, and a free fitness center. Additional conveniences feature a Terrace, soundproof rooms, Non-smoking rooms, wheelchair accessibility, an elevator, private entrance, and views, plus a bathtub with free toiletries.

Chef's! Food & Drink anchors the on-site dining scene, offering Colombian and French flavors that can feel lively and family-friendly or chicly romantic. The setting pairs well with a drink from the Bar, making evenings after a day of Groningen exploring delightfully easy and social.
The room lineup is diverse, with options around 215 to 323 square feet. Deluxe rooms hover near 270 square feet, while the Junior Suite offers extra space at 323 square feet. Apartment-style options can accommodate larger groups, and multiple layouts provide a range of bed configurations to fit couples, families, and bigger parties.
Practical touches include a 24-hour front desk, free WiFi, and air conditioning for comfort any time of year. A terrace offers views, and there’s a private entrance for guest convenience. Payment is by Visa, Mastercard, American Express, ATM card, or Maestro, with cash not accepted. This setup makes planning an easy, enjoyable Groningen base for any itinerary.

A state-of-the-art hotel with excellent facilities. The cuisine is excellent, the food is delicious, whether you have breakfast or dinner. Crucially, the bed is comfortable. An unexpected surprise for us was that I received a "Guest of the Day" gift, which meant we received free wine with our dinner.
One drawback of the modern, glass architecture is its noisy nature. You can hear distinct and quite loud creaking sounds as the temperature outside changes. Furthermore, the hotel is running an aggressive marketing campaign to convince guests to install their mobile app. The numerous messages on all fronts, including WhatsApp and email, can irritate some guests.

The hotel is located inside a building designed by a famous architect. It really is comfy, with a nice large terrace going around it and an excellent restaurant. A few details make the difference in feeling cared for, like nice notes in the room, a postcard delivery system, a coffee machine for an early coffee. The bed is super comfy, and for the first time I found a bathtub long enough so that I could fit straight (I'm rather tall). Ah, and the room was a corner room, with a single huge window covering the two sides. Coupled with the beautiful weather we were blessed with, it was a top experience.
The location is the only obvious minus. It's a 25-min walk to the station, which means a 40-min wall from the central historical squares, but it's well connected by public transportation. The neighborhood seemed pretty quiet. There was a small misunderstanding with the staff for a drink in the terrace, but nothing major.

The room was nice, modern, two walls of windows, giving a good view out over the gardens and the city. The restaurant was definitely a cut above a standard hotel restaurant - the ribs were really good and there were some interesting local beers to try.
The hotel is 'upside down' - the reception is on the 3rd floor and the rooms are on the floors below. This gives the bar/restaurant a view, but I didn't like that I had to take the lift and not the stairs to access my room - it was only 1 floor and this is wasteful of energy.

At what times are check-in and check-out at Leonardo Hotel Groningen?
At Leonardo Hotel Groningen, check-in is available from 03:00 PM until 11:00 PM, and check-out is by 12:00 PM.
Is free parking available at Leonardo Hotel Groningen?
Yes, there is parking available at Leonardo Hotel Groningen. The hotel provides private parking on site for a price of €10 per day. However, it is not possible to make a parking reservation.
